Grant and Mike, the guys who put on Born-Free, give away a bike each year through a raffle and this year is no exception. 18 of the invited builders have given the ok to have the winner pick one of their show bikes....PRETTY AWESOME!

Here's how to enter-
Buy this kickass BF5 Poster ($25) and get your free raffle ticket from Lowbrow on Feb. 1st. The winner MUST BE PRESENT TO WIN this year, so make plans to be there.

Here's the latest on the BF 5 Giveaway Bike & if you don't already know Born-Free has a blog full of updates ,show info,photos and videos.  www.bornfreeshow.com Doing these giveaway bike has been a lot of fun and very exciting...but always a tough decision on what to do each year and how to make it better and keep you all interested.What trumps the 50 Panhead of BF2? a 46 Knuckle for BF3.. kinda hard to beat a Knuckle but 2 69 Shovel's at BF4 did the trick...It's BF 5 and now what do we do? Here is the plan.... We have gotten together with some of our builders (14 as of today) more to be announced soon. These guys will build their totally new show bikes for the BF5 builder invite..They will build some of the best Knuckles,Pans,Shovels,Flatheads,Triumphs, ect on the planet .We will sell our original artwork posters w/free tickets that will enter you in the promo just like previous years but instead of us pre-determining the bike we give away...the winner does. Yes you!! You buy a poster w/ free ticket and if your number is pulled at the show you will be able to pick ( one ) bike from the builders that are participating in the promo... You pick your favorite bike from your favorite builder! The decision is yours. We will have much more info and details soon... This year you must be present to win! Again you must be present to win! So make your plans now. Here are just some of the builders who have committed :: Andy Carter (Pangea Speed),Big Scott(Cycle Zombies), Josh Conely,Bill Mize,Caleb Owens,Chopper Dave,Dave Barker,Dave Polgreen,Joey( The Fish) Cano,Kiyo,Larry( Garage Company Customs) Todd Asin,Kouske( SunRise Cycles)and Max Schaaf. One lucky soul will win the bike of their dreams on June 29 Th. 2013....Born-Free 5
